Position Summary
The IT Manager leads a team that focuses on the intersection of technology and library services, providing strategic and operational leadership for the District's information technology to support all users of Library systems - internal and external. The IT Manager oversees technology infrastructure development and maintenance, network management, technology hardware management, cybersecurity, and daily IT department operations, including the public website and intranet. The IT Manager works with library leadership to identify and recommend technologies that support the growth and strategic direction of the District.

Duties and Responsibilities
- Responsible for the overall planning and managerial operations of the District's IT functions including long-term strategic and short-term operational goals.
- Oversees the day-to-day work of the IT department, including installation, deployment, operation, and maintenance of software and hardware; user support; technology needs analysis; and the administration and operation of computer and other information technology equipment and telecommunications systems.
- Supervises information technology staff and creates a work environment that encourages high performance, collaboration, and excellent customer service.
- Develops, implements, and maintains efficient processes and standard operating procedures for the organization's IT systems and department staff.
- Manages the administrative functions of the department including authorizing financial transactions, contract administration, project management, departmental documentation, and inventory.
- Monitors and evaluates the efficiency and efficacy of the District's technology infrastructure, service delivery methods, and procedures.
- Serves as a backup in maintaining the Library's website, built in WordPress.
- Develops and implements business continuity of operations protocols to minimize disruption to business operations in the event of emergency situations, power outages, or data loss.
- Ensures the District's cybersecurity posture through the security of systems, networks, and enterprise information, as well as adhering to best practices in library privacy and confidentiality values.
- Facilitates IT security audits or investigations.
- Prepares and evaluates competitive bids and RFPs in accordance with Oregon procurement and District policies.
- Develops and maintains relationships with external IT vendors and service providers.
- Identifies and implements emerging technologies for use by staff and / or patrons.
- In conjunction with the Assistant Director of Support Services, develops and leads the objectives outlined in the 3-year rolling Technology Plan.
- Regular attendance.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
Compensation
JCLS has a 16-step salary schedule with each step at 1.5%. The starting salary will be based on steps 1-5 of the schedule. New hires are placed based on applicable education and experience to the job, as well as keeping within Oregon state pay equity laws. The starting range for this position is $97,785 to $103,878 per year.
